Beer-Onion-Jalapeno Cheese Bread

Spicy beer bread with jalapenos and onions for a flavorful twist.
Ingredients:
  • 8 ounces flat lager-style beer
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1 tablespoon sugar
  • 1.5 teaspoons salt
  • 3 cups bread flour
  • 1 package yeast
  • 4 ounces pepper jack cheese, shredded
  • 4 ounces Asiago cheese, shredded
  • 2 jalapeno peppers, seeded and chopped
  • 0.25 cup chopped onions
Instructions:
  • Gently warm beer and butter in a saucepan on low heat until the butter melts and the temperature reaches 115 to 120 degrees F (45 to 50 degrees C).
  • Combine the flavorful pepper jack cheese, savory Asiago cheese, fragrant onions, and spicy jalapeno peppers in a bowl and mix well.
  • Pour the beer and butter mixture into the bread machine pan. Sprinkle in the sugar, salt, and flour in that order. Make a 2-inch well in the flour and add the yeast; cover it with flour. Sprinkle half of the cheese mixture on top.
  • Choose the Basic or White Bread cycle and begin the machine.
  • Add the rest of the cheese mixture into the bread machine after 30 minutes. Let the machine continue processing. Once done, transfer the loaf onto a wire rack to cool for approximately 20 minutes.
